summaryrefslogtreecommitdiff
path: root/.gitlab-ci.yml
diff options
context:
space:
mode:
authorMichel Dänzer <mdaenzer@redhat.com>2020-03-23 18:16:07 +0100
committerMarge Bot <eric+marge@anholt.net>2020-03-28 16:12:38 +0000
commitfcd3377cfe23e419b9235424cef9db4792fac80b (patch)
tree25632f398c4ef783e0d6d7f1f8ae214c305fe307 /.gitlab-ci.yml
parent447890ad64cb64bacafce8402e013b81e09359fe (diff)
downloadmesa-fcd3377cfe23e419b9235424cef9db4792fac80b.tar.gz
gitlab-ci: Update to current templates
The .fdo.container-ifnot-exists template has been replaced by .fdo.container-build. We need to include "debian/" in FDO_REPO_SUFFIX for now, we can drop it for individual images when their tags are bumped if we want. Miscellaneous other goodies this gets us: * The templates now add some labels to images which may be useful for garbage collecting unused tags in the future. * The templates now copy the current tag from the main project registry to the forked project's if it already exists in the latter but points to a different image hash. This will avoid false failures (or passes) due to using the wrong image. Tested-by: Marge Bot <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/4286>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/4286>
Diffstat (limited to '.gitlab-ci.yml')
-rw-r--r--.gitlab-ci.yml8
1 files changed, 4 insertions, 4 deletions
diff --git a/.gitlab-ci.yml b/.gitlab-ci.yml
index e30915c7e05..c9c4f8f941c 100644
--- a/.gitlab-ci.yml
+++ b/.gitlab-ci.yml
@@ -3,7 +3,7 @@ variables:
include:
- project: 'freedesktop/ci-templates'
- ref: a1699326519fd28526485ce93464e33423bac564
+ ref: 4b2997287317808830e9cb4eb0f99b691787da88
file: '/templates/debian.yml'
- local: '.gitlab-ci/lava-gitlab-ci.yml'
- local: '.gitlab-ci/test-source-dep.yml'
@@ -110,7 +110,7 @@ success:
- .ci-run-policy
variables:
FDO_DISTRIBUTION_VERSION: buster-slim
- FDO_REPO_SUFFIX: $CI_JOB_NAME
+ FDO_REPO_SUFFIX: "debian/$CI_JOB_NAME"
FDO_DISTRIBUTION_EXEC: 'bash .gitlab-ci/container/${CI_JOB_NAME}.sh'
# no need to pull the whole repo to build the container image
GIT_STRATEGY: none
@@ -118,7 +118,7 @@ success:
# Debian 10 based x86 build image
x86_build:
extends:
- - .fdo.container-ifnot-exists@debian
+ - .fdo.container-build@debian
- .container
variables:
FDO_DISTRIBUTION_TAG: &x86_build "2020-03-13"
@@ -159,7 +159,7 @@ x86_build_old:
# Debian 10 based ARM build image
arm_build:
extends:
- - .fdo.container-ifnot-exists@debian@arm64v8
+ - .fdo.container-build@debian@arm64v8
- .container
variables:
FDO_DISTRIBUTION_TAG: &arm_build "2020-03-24"